fbpx

Cloud Hosting: A Comprehensive Guide

Cloud Hosting

Why are so many companies making the move to cloud hosting today? Cloud hosting works differently from traditional web hosting. Businesses have begun to move towards cloud hosting to meet everyday needs effectively. These servers are used for web hosting, application development, remotely accessible desktop work environments, and more. As Computing power and storage are shared among traditional customers, a sudden traffic spike from a neighboring website could slow down your website.

In contrast, cloud web hosting services with virtualization technology divide physical servers into multiple virtual servers. These services use a network of servers to host websites and provide better performance and stability than single-server hosting services. In this article, we will discuss the definition of cloud hosting, the types and benefits of cloud hosting, the security of cloud computing, and what a user can do with a cloud server.

Let’s dive in!

What Is Cloud Hosting?

Cloud hosting is outsourcing an organization’s storage and computing resources to a service provider that offers infrastructure services in a utility model. It comes when an application or website is run on a virtual server in the cloud. A cloud-hosted server is a virtual server that hosts data and applications in a cloud computing environment.

Organizations hosted applications on physical servers in on-premise data centers or hired from hosting providers. In cloud web hosting,  cloud providers host applications across physical and virtual servers spanning diverse geographic locations. This method is more flexible than traditional ones. You access computing resources from an existing resource pool and can quickly scale applications up or down. And don’t worry about provisioning the right amount of resources.

Cloud-based VM hosting differs from traditional web hosting because it typically uses a centralized approach, where a single web server hosts multiple websites. Cloud computing hosting heavily invests in robust security systems and gives users high-level security. Update and patch systems so users are always up to date with decent security frameworks. The attention to security allows users to offer various disaster recovery options. The top cloud hosting provider provides additional data backup and recovery mechanisms for add-on capability.

Comparing Cloud, Web, VPS, Shared, and Dedicated Hosting

Choosing the right hosting solution, whether cloud, web, VPS, shared, or dedicated hosting, depends on specific needs, balancing cost, performance, scalability, and control to ensure optimal website functionality and user experience.

1. Cloud Hosting VS Web Hosting:

Cloud computing hosting and web hosting are different. In web hosting, a website needs some resources due to increased demand, and the user has to change the service plan to have more computing power, creating the issue of scalability.

Cloud hosting separates the site’s content across people’s virtual servers in different regions. When demand increases, it is easy to scale without any worries with cloud website hosting. People like Cloud Computing hosting because it offers a robust and better view than web hosting, providing more flexibility to tune parameters as needed.

2. Cloud Hosting VS VPS:

VPS is a virtual isolated environment hosted on a single server. The hosting provider places a hypervisor on top of the operating system to divide it into separate components. VPS sometimes refers to a private server. If we compare VPS vs Cloud hosting, VPS is similar to cloud website hosting as they both offer customization. Cloud web hosting provides a platform to maintain and stay placed on a limited number of machines. Still, it does not have the inherent scalability, reliability, and flexibility of cloud hosting. 

With a global network upgrade, hardware offers features like CDN and cloud website hosting, which provide better performance and speed than a VPS. It is mid-range and most suitable for growing businesses.

3. Cloud Hosting VS Shared Hosting:

Cloud hosting is the best option for websites that require a more robust hosting solution than shared hosting. It provides its user’s auto-scaling option to add more resources to the server upon traffic spikes.

Shared hosting is the most widely used and affordable type of hosting service. In shared hosting, many websites share the space of physical servers and resources. WP Cloud hosting is powerful because you can access the whole server all by yourself and don’t share it.  In shared hosting, a user has the experience of managing and creating hosting accounts on the server and configuring it. It is the Cheapest and best for small websites.

4. Cloud Hosting VS Dedicated Hosting:

Dedicated hosting is better than shared hosting, but more is needed for high-traffic websites that need to offer a higher degree of user experience to visitors. Cheap Cloud hosting Malaysia is sound in sudden traffic spikes, and the demands for website resources increase as traffic increases. 

As the website grows, the cloud server adapts and provides the necessary resources. Customers benefit from both types of hosting, which are available on cloud web hosting services. Dedicated server hosting is the most expensive and best for large companies with specific needs.

Comparison Table of Cloud, Web, VPS, Shared, and Dedicated Hosting

FeatureCloud Hosting Web Hosting VPS Hosting Shared HostingDedicated Hosting 
DefinitionUses a network of virtual servers pulling resources from multiple physical servers.The general term for hosting services can include shared VPS or dedicated.A virtualized server with dedicated resources within a physical server.Multiple websites share their resources on a single server.A single server dedicated to one client.
PerformanceHigh performance with scalable resources cloud network.Based on type, performance can be low in shared and high in dedicated.Improved performance with allocated resources.Lower performance due to shared resources.Highest performance with total server resources.
ScalabilityHigh performance can be adjusted dynamically based on needs.Varies; cloud offers high scalability while shared is limited.  Moderate, can upgrade resources but within limits of a physical server.Limited dependence on server capacity.Limited by physical server capacity, which requires hardware changes.
CostThe variable, often the pay-as-you-go model, is more cost-effective for scaling businesses.Varies, shared is the cheapest, and dedicated is the most expensive.Mid-range,  most suitable for growing business.Cheapest, best for small websites.It is most expensive and best for large companies with specific needs.
Security Strong security with isolated resources and advanced cloud security features.Varies generally good security, but shared hosting could be more secure.Better security in isolated environments.Lower security is affected by other users on the server.High security: The user cannot control all security measures.
CustomizationFlexibility depends on the provider offering configuration options.Varies are dedicated, allowing complete control; shared is limited.High: Root access allows for extensive customization.They are limited based on shared server capabilities.Complete customization control over server configuration and software.
Technical KnowledgeVaries are usually managed by the provider but may require technical understanding for setup.Varies are minimal for shared and more for VPS.Moderate technical expertise is needed to manage the server setting.Minimal management by the provider.Highly required technical knowledge to manage the server.
Use CasesWebsites with fluctuating traffic and large-scale applications.General use, small to medium websites.Medium size businesses, an E-commerce website.Small blogs and personal websites.High-traffic sites and large Enterprises.
Comparison Table of Cloud, Web, VPS, Shared, and Dedicated Hosting

How Does Cloud Hosting Work?

The working of cloud-based VM hosting is as follows:

1. Understanding Virtualization In Cloud Hosting:

Cloud web hosting solutions use virtualization technology to run multiple virtual servers on a single physical server. Each virtual machine has a fixed pool of resources, such as storage, memory, and CPU, from which to draw. Visualization is fundamental to Cloud Computing because it enables efficient resource use, allowing cloud users to purchase computing resources as needed and scale them efficiently. 

These can run independently to other virtual machines on the same physical server.  Each virtual machine is isolated, and individuals can deploy different applications and servers, worrying about interference or compatibility. 

Cloud hosting business providers lease out the virtual servers to customers to access as required. Depending on demand, the cloud host allocates multiple virtual machines and resources to them. 

2. Resource Allocation And Scalability:

With a highly flexible system, organizations quickly deploy new VMs, allocate more computing power to an existing one, and adopt IT infrastructure as required. Users can access WP cloud hosting solutions through easy-to-use web-based user interfaces in software, hardware, and service requests that are instantly delivered. Even software and hardware updates happen automatically.

3. Virtualization Role In Cloud Hosting:

Cloud Web hosting also uses virtualization to create a highly effective, scalable, yet isolated system. Customers enlist remote servers to access stores and resources and manage data, services, and applications from cloud computing hosting providers. As in-house and WP cloud hosting approaches, non-functional scalability requirements, high availability, and reliability remain the same. 

Meanwhile, cloud computing hosting provides a broader pool of IT resources to deliver these requirements confidently.

4. Meeting Non-Functional Requirements With Cloud Hosting:

Scalability, reliability, and high availability can be automatically tailored to organizations’ solution requirements. This capability is called application-aware service provisioning and is implemented through software-defined environments. SDEs automatically and dynamically provision computing, network, and data storage resources according to application needs, minimizing efficiencies and optimizing services.

Benefits Of Cloud Hosting

Cloud hosting solutions provide significant capital and savings to organizations because they do not have to spend a lot on initial upfront capital costs associated with owning and managing data centers.

Cloud computing hosting is increasingly popular due to its stability, scalability, and high performance, and it has a lot of benefits. Some tops are given below:

1. Easy To Scale Server Resources:

WP Cloud hosting scales server resources, so they cannot be more accessible. For some cloud servers, access to the site management dashboard lets users view site performance in real time. Individuals can scale the server resources up and down without waiting for approval from the hosting provider. 

Local hosting’s most significant disadvantage is investing in hardware and its required infrastructure. After a front cost, users must pay for ongoing maintenance, which proves costly. Cloud server hosting offers pay-as-you systems and eradicates the need for maintenance costs.

2. Simple Server Management Dashboard:

In previous cloud servers, users found managing them a little complicated and required a technical export to scale the server. But in today’s cloud computing hosting, users can easily keep track of their hosting and scale it on demand with a dashboard. 

Cloud servers do not require a technical background to run, so having a simple server management dashboard in cloud hosting is more convenient than ever.

3. Faster Website Speed And Performance:

Cloud servers provide fast speeds to facilitate their users. They effortlessly increase site capacity, enable load balancing between multiple server environments, and help enforce strain on a single server’s resources.

The server hardware Foundation influences a site’s speed, so looking for a cloud host with multiple caching layers, low-density servers, and premium server hardware is advisable.

4. Best Cloud Web Hosting Uptime And Availability:

Site uptime depends on the physical server environment, as in traditional hosting. If it goes offline, so does your site unless utilizing a CDN helps to reduce site overall downtime. 

Cloud website hosting has uptime built into the structure. The site could use multiple servers virtually, and individuals could transfer to another server to go offline or experience technical issues. Plus, with the ability to scale cloud server resources on demand, the site won’t go offline due to an unexpected traffic surge. Cloud computing hosting isolates a site from physical server issues or system overload. 

Many cloud hosting providers have data centers worldwide, reducing latency and increasing availability. They also have an additional fail-over mechanism to protect services. Web cloud services companies invest in Technology and content delivery networks to ensure customer access to highly available services and applications. These companies show that applications are highly available and easily used in all geographical regions. 

5. Speedy Server Setup Process:

Individuals can deploy a cloud web hosting server in record time unless they sign up as a beginner shared hosting package. It can take some time to deploy a web server. If an individual needs a site quickly or to a host migration and is stuck waiting for the server to be ready. 

It is also the best hosting solution beyond traditional shared hosting, so users find cloud hosting strictly to decrease their overall environmental impact. With web cloud services, it is possible to utilize fewer overall data centers and only use the server resources required.

Types Of Cloud Web Hosting

Cloud hosting is continuously growing in popularity as Enterprises replace the long-term maintenance of physical services with the public cloud’s scalable and flexible computing resources. The major cloud computing models include public cloud, private cloud, and hybrid cloud, with four primary services:   Infrastructure as a service,  Software as a service (SaaS), Platform as a service (PaaS), and serverless computing.

When adopting cloud architecture, there are different cloud development models for delivering Cloud Computing services: public cloud, private cloud, and hybrid cloud. Details are given below:

1. Private Cloud:

Private clouds are run and used by a single Organization located on premises. They are responsible for greater customization control and data security with costs and resource limitations similar to traditional IT environments.

2. Public Cloud:

The public cloud delivers resources like storage computing networks and develops and deploys environments for applications over the internet owned and run by third-party services like Google Cloud.

3. Hybrid Cloud:

Environments that mix one private cloud computing with one or more public ones are known as hybrid clouds. They allow their users to access one or more public cloud resources and services from a lot of computing environments, and for choosing the best cloud website hosting and optimal,

Cloud development industry searches show that nearly 90% of companies considered multi-cloud due to combining cloud services from two Cloud Service Providers, whether public or private. A multi-cloud approach provides flexibility and the best solutions to suit specific business needs while reducing vendor race.

Multi-cloud and hybrid cloud are used interchangeably, but the hybrid cloud can be considered multi-cloud if a user wants to use services for multiple public cloud providers.

Types Of Cloud Services

Here are three main Cloud Service models. 

1. Infrastructure As A Service(IaaS):

IaaS service demands infrastructure resources like networking, storage, computing, and virtualization. Infrastructure services provide the user with the need to buy and manage software like operating system applications and data. 

2. Software As A Service (SAAS):

SaaS gives an entire application stack as a service where users can use and access solutions provided by ready-to-use applications managed and maintained by a Cloud Service Provider, highlighting the advantages of Cloud-based SaaS vs Dedicated Server setups.

3. Platform As A Service (PAAS):

PaaS manages and delivers Software and Hardware resources to develop, test, and manage cloud applications. Users offer middleware development tools and cloud databases with PaaS offerings.

4. Serverless Computing:

Serverless computing is one cloud service model that functions as a service. This model allows users to build applications without scaling or managing any infrastructure.

Cloud computing Technology wanted to accelerate digital transformations with organizations from computing storage to cloud databases and development tools with advanced Data Analytics and AI/ ML capabilities.

The cost of cloud computing saves money on IT infrastructure and technology, irrespective of the cost of building and maintaining expensive data centers. Companies adopt virtual servers and cloud-based IT solutions, which require paying for what they consume.

Cloud Computing Security

The client organization and its service provider share hosting responsibility. The cloud contributes to a broad range of features and technology policies for addressing internal and external threats to business security. 

Cloud hosting providers have stored data for years to protect against malicious attacks or threats, such as firewalls, identity management, and securing socket layers. 

They also prevent data loss, provide regular store updates, and monitor the site 24/7. Cloud data also offers physical security, such as guards and surveillance systems, to prevent unauthorized access.

What Can I Do With A Cloud Server?

You can do many essential functions with a cloud server, from website running, private analytics, keeping private copies of backups, setting up RSS readers, and Forex trading. Let’s discuss them briefly:

1. Running A Website:

Running a website is one popular reason for using an independent server. However, there are many other reasons for a user to do that. Individuals can also run their PCs on a cloud instance. 

Cloud servers give dedicated resources for websites that users cannot get with a shared business plan or hosting. Customers get better performance and handle more traffic running simultaneously, offering more control and access to root. The option is to install whatever software apps and scripts the user wants rather than the shared hosting.

2. Keep Private Copies of Back-Up:

It helps users store remote backups on their servers even if they don’t have a place to store them. Having multiple backups of one website database and a lot of information is crucial to quickly recovering in case of any incident or mishap.

3. Setting Up RSS Reader:

Some rely on third-party RSS readers to keep their favorite information, and others use Google Reader. With their server, users don’t worry about information loss. Cloud Server quickly sets up RSS readers to feed daily information, depending on an individual’s app script software.

  • Sync to any device from which to access feeds.
  • Customize the look and feel.
  • Plugins for the use of keyboard shortcuts and the ability to share.
  • XBMC for big-screen viewing.
  • Run private analytics and create a managed game server.

Instead of Google Analytics and 3rd party services, users can install self-hosted analytics and choose to install it. 

There are also a lot of applications available to choose from according to each business’s needs. Some users use data mining, drawing data-driven, easy-to-understand reports. And some powerful ones for letting in both. A powerful tool is tremendously beneficial in the rapidly growing age of enormous data. 

4. Test New Software & Apps.

With cloud server hosting for small businesses, individuals can save from many headaches and spend unnecessary money. Test everything and make sure it works and not screw anything up. Then, add it to the central server or website with peace of mind. Know nothing wonky is happening to stress you.

5. Forex Trading Or Gunbit Trading:

Are you a Forex trader? Cloud servers benefit forex traders because many traders rely somewhat on automation if a user runs it on a PC in case of loss of power. What happens? If the user uses a cloud server, it firmly takes out energy from the night the trading keeps going without any worries.

A cloud server user can trade anytime, anywhere, and the trading time is not limited to a PC. When accessing the work interface, the user also has to say no to slippage to reduce the delay and ultimately reduce stress. This holds even if you are the type to place all your orders manually.

Conclusion

Cloud Web hosting solutions employ a virtual infrastructure for managing a website as businesses move towards it daily. Compared to traditional web hosting, cloud website hosting offers increased reliability and minimizes hardware failure risks when performing stable sites. Web cloud services are the cost-adequate middle ground with effective customization and upgrade potential. 

Cloud-based web hosting is ideal for building large-scale projects like enterprise websites, E-Commerce stores, social networks, and popular cloud hosting platforms. You should choose VPS Malaysia for the best and most reliable Cloud hosting services that fit your budget and business needs. I hope this guide helps you understand cloud hosting and deploy the best solution for your business. Have any questions? Ask in the comment section below!

Ready to elevate your online presence? Explore our Best Cloud Server Hosting solutions now!

Leave a Reply